1/安装Eclipse 3.2
2/安装MyEclipse 5.0GA
3/安装C++ Devloper Toolkit(CDT)
org.eclipse.cdt.sdk-3.1.0-win32.x86.rar
4/安装MinGW C&C++ 编译环境
版本 5.1.3
mingw-runtime-3.11.tar
mingw-utils-0.3.tar
w32api-3.8.tar
binutils-2.16.91-20060119-1.tar
gcc-core-3.4.5-20060117-1.tar
gcc-g++-3.4.5-20060117-1.tar
mingw32-make-3.81-1.tar
MinGW-5.1.3.exe
5/安装gdb c& c++ 调试工具
(安装过程中要选择MinGW安装目录)
gdb-5.2.1-1-src.tar
gdb-5.2.1-1.exe
6/安装msys
MSYS-1.0.10.exe
7/设置环境变量
Path =D:/msys/1.0/bin;
D:/MinGW/bin;D:/bea/jdk150_03/bin;
%SystemRoot%/system32;%SystemRoot%;
JAVA_HOME =D:/bea/jdk150_03
CLASS_PATH=D:/bea/jdk150_03/lib;
D:/bea/jdk150_03/lib/dt.jar;
D:/bea/jdk150_03/lib/tools.jar
LIBRARY_PATH=D:/MinGW/lib
C_INCLUDE_PATH=D:/MinGW/include
CPLUS_INCLUDE_PATH=D:/MinGW/include/c++/3.4.5;
D:/MinGW/include/c++/3.4.5/mingw32;
D:/MinGW/include/c++/3.4.5/backward;
D:/MinGW/include;
8/进入MyEclipse,修改
Window->Preferences->C/C++->Make->NewMakeProject->BinaryParser
将Elf Parser 修改为 PE Windows Parser
我遇到问题:
1/使用gdb 在dos下调试正常,在Eclipse下调试有
找不到应用 "No such File"提示
导致该问题是因为在eclipse 中将WINDOWS路径 /t 解释成 TAB
在调试界面编辑"EDIT testPro"将"C/C++ Application"属性改为
Debug//testPro.exe 调试成功.
2/如果开发linux 下的程序,可以将用到的.H文件复制到环境变量指定的目录